Into the Woods is about a witch (Meryl Streep) that tasks a childless baker (James Corden) and his wife (Emily Blunt) with finding magical items from the woods. The magical items are from known classic fairy tales like Little Red Riding Hood, Jack in the Beanstalk, Rapunzel and Cinderella. The baker and his wife are sent to find them to reverse the curse put on their family tree. The beginning of the movie quickly sets the tone for a fun musical filled with magic and mystery.

4. Modern Take on Grimm Fairy Tales. Into the Woods is a modern take on grimm fairy tales, The Brothers Grimm fairy tales. I love learning about the grimm fairy tales and how different they are than what we actually let our children believe. Into the Woods shows us that what you wish for can actually come true. You should be careful what you wish for. Although it is about grimm fairy tales, I believe it’s fine for the whole family and children six or seven and older. I know my son would have been fine watching it at age six. Although this is a darker movie for Disney, I do not believe this is a scary movie… at all!
